India, May 9 -- Nine Bangladesh nationals, who had been working in Rajasthan for a year, were arrested in West Bengal's Uttar Dinjapur district on Friday when they were trying to cross the Indo-Bangladesh border to return home, officials said.
The nine were intercepted by the Border Security Force (BSF).
A BSF officer said they had illegally entered the country and had been working in Rajasthan for about a year as daily wage labourers.
"Acting on specific information, troops of the BSF's Kishanganj sector held the illegal Bangladeshis from Daspara village in Uttar Dinajpur district," said a BSF official.
